Nash,, please bolt headers to down pipe and measure distance (offset) between both flanges at both sides of bolt holes,, ie, hole 1 to 5 and hole 4 to 8,, this distance variance will give you a idea how close to "true" with the head. Also how they compare with your standard from COMPTECH. I'm sure you remember how I measured the auto units.
